Steel Suspensions

    In trying to figure out why the Steel were so desperately shorthanded this weekend, I finally decided to look on the team's transaction list. Courtesy of the massive brawl in Dubuque on December 15th, four Steel players received two-game suspensions: Defensemen Joel Benson and Sam Piazza, and forwards Thomas Ebbing and Charlie O'Connor.

    All four players' suspensions will be over after today (Saturday)'s game in Muskegon. Johnny Wingels didn't get a suspension, and also hasn't skated either game this weekend. No word yet on him, nor why the team felt the need to call up Biagio Lerario just to not skate him.
